Job DetailsJob Location: Remote - Remote, MA 02129Position Type: Full TimeSalary Range: $116,596.00 - $163,282.00 SalaryJob Shift: AnyJob Category: Remote/HybridFounded in 1876, the Appalachian Mountain Club is the oldest conservation, education, and outdoor recreation organization in the United States. AMC helps people enjoy and protect the outdoors through conservation, recreation, lodging, education, and volunteer-led experiences across the Northeast.
AMC is hiring a Director of Product to lead a new product function and help guide a multi-year technology roadmap across member and donor systems, lodging and booking, volunteer technology, data, and shared platforms. This role will translate organizational priorities into clear product decisions, connect business needs with technology delivery, and build practical ways for AMC to prioritize, sequence, and measure technology work. This role reports to the Vice President of Technology and works closely with leaders across AMC’s business, operations, and mission teams. Product at AMC is business-facing, technology-aware, and accountable for value. The Director of Product will partner closely with technology leaders who own architecture, systems, integrations, infrastructure, project coordination, and support.
The role can be remote, but the candidate must be within driving distance of AMC’s lodges and locations for attending meetings, staff gatherings, and other events.
What You Will Lead
You will lead product strategy and execution across AMC’s highest-priority technology streams:
Member and donor experience, including CRM, membership, giving, self-service, and constituent data.
Lodging, booking, and hospitality technology, including guest experience, reservation platforms, and related integrations.
Volunteer and community systems, including onboarding, access, communications, and support experiences.
Data, reporting, integrations, and shared platforms that help AMC operate as a more connected organization.
What You Will Be Doing At AMC
Own and refine AMC’s product roadmap, organizing work around measurable mission and business outcomes.
Translate AMC’s technology roadmap into clear priorities, sequencing, tradeoffs, risks, and decisions.
Convert business and user needs into clear requirements, user stories, acceptance criteria, success metrics, and launch plans.
Establish practical product practices for intake, prioritization, backlog ownership, sprint readiness, stakeholder review, release planning, and adoption measurement.
Lead product reviews with senior leaders, clearly communicating progress, risks, dependencies, and decisions needed.
Partner with technology leaders, implementation partners, business stakeholders, and frontline users to ensure work is valuable, feasible, adopted, and measurable.
Coach product managers or product owners and set a standard for transparent prioritization and disciplined delivery.
